Sunway chairman Cheah wins EY award


PETALING JAYA: Sunway Group founder and chairman Tan Sri Jeffrey Cheah has been named the winner of this year’s EY Asean Entrepreneurial Excellence Award, which recognises successful South-East Asian businesses that contribute to the economy and community in the region.

Cheah noted that EY is one of the world’s most prestigious accounting and consulting firms, adding that he was humbled to receive the award.
